Jacks Dip
A tangy, flavorful dip with herbs and spices, perfect for serving with fresh vegetables or chips at gatherings or casual snacking sessions.

Instructions
- Mix mayonnaise, tarragon vinegar, pepper, salt, thyme, curry powder, chili sauce, horseradish, chopped chives, and grated onion well.
- Serve the dip with fresh vegetables.
Tips & Substitutions
For a creamier texture, consider using Greek yogurt instead of mayonnaise. If you want to reduce the heat, substitute chili sauce with ketchup. Fresh herbs can elevate the flavor; try swapping out chives for dill or parsley based on your preference. Additionally, if you want to enhance the curry flavor, increase the amount of curry powder gradually while tasting.
Serving Suggestions
This dip pairs beautifully with fresh vegetables like carrots, celery, and bell peppers for a healthy snack. You can also serve it alongside crackers or use it as a spread on sandwiches. For a fun twist, consider incorporating it into a Walking Salad, where it can serve as a delicious dressing.
Storage & Reheating
Store any leftover dip in an airtight container in the refrigerator. It will keep well for up to 3 days. If the dip thickens after chilling, stir in a little mayonnaise or yogurt to restore its creamy consistency. Avoid freezing as the texture may change upon thawing.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I make this dip ahead of time?
Yes, you can prepare Jack's Dip a day in advance. Just make sure to store it in an airtight container in the fridge. The flavors will meld together nicely, and it will be ready to serve when you need it. Just give it a good stir before serving.
What are some alternatives to mayonnaise in this recipe?
If you want to avoid mayonnaise, you can use Greek yogurt, sour cream, or a vegan mayonnaise alternative. These substitutes will provide a similar creamy texture while adding their unique flavors. Just keep in mind that the taste may vary slightly depending on the substitute used.
How spicy is this dip?
The spice level in Jack's Dip can be adjusted based on your preference. The chili sauce adds a bit of heat, but you can reduce or omit it for a milder flavor. Alternatively, you can enhance the spiciness by adding more chili sauce or incorporating a pinch of cayenne pepper.
